§ 01The problem

Your church does not have a software problem. It has a knowing problem.

Most church management systems were built for transactions: giving, attendance, room scheduling. They track what people did. They cannot tell you who they are.

Pastors and team leaders end up doing the work the software should. Remembering names. Guessing at gifts. Hand-matching people to groups. Watching new attenders disappear before anyone connects with them.

The opposite of disengagement is not another program. It is being known.

§ 03Inside the matching engine

AI you can read, not just trust.

Most AI matching tools return a single score with no audit trail. DiscipleIQ separates the two jobs AI is good at and shows its work on both.

pgvector · Your secure, trained AI · Postgres
01

Embeddings for semantic similarity

Every profile and every opportunity is encoded as a vector. Finding the right mentor for a specific person becomes a real query, not a hand-tagged guess.

02

Rules for the hard requirements

Same campus. Available on Tuesday nights. Has childcare. Not currently overloaded. These are filters, not probabilities. They belong in SQL, and that is where we keep them.

03

Your secure, trained AI writes the explanation

Every match comes with two or three sentences a pastor can read before forwarding. Why this person. Why now. Where the friction might be. No black box.

04

Admins stay in the loop

Matches above your confidence threshold send automatically. Everything below queues for a leader to review, edit, or override. You set the threshold.

§ 08Trust

Boring infrastructure choices, on purpose.

Member data and assessment results are sensitive. We picked the most defensible stack we could find and put it behind the controls your IT lead will ask about.

Supabase Postgres

Single system of record. Daily backups. Point-in-time recovery on the Pro plan.

Row-level security

Tenant isolation enforced at the database layer, not in application code. One less category of bug.

Encrypted tokens

Planning Center OAuth tokens stored in Supabase Vault, scoped per tenant.

Stripe payments

All transactions PCI compliant by default. Subscriptions, one-time payments, and refunds handled cleanly.

Encryption and MFA

SSL across the platform. MFA required for admin and super-admin accounts.

Consent-only outreach

No cold spam to mentors. Every outbound message is invited or opted into.

How does DiscipleIQ work with the church management system we already use?

We offer two-way sync with Planning Center. People, custom fields, and group membership stay aligned automatically. Ministry Platform, Fellowship One, and Breeze are on the V2 roadmap. For other systems, our open API and embed widgets cover most use cases.

What does AI matching actually mean here?

Two things. First, every profile and opportunity is encoded as a semantic vector, which surfaces non-obvious good fits. Second, your secure, trained AI writes a plain-language explanation for every recommendation. Why this person. Why now. Where the friction might be. Admins control the auto-approve threshold. Everything below it queues for review.

Is the mentor pool real opt-in mentors, or just a contact list?

Real and opt-in. The pool starts with curated leader data, and we run a consent workflow before any mentor receives outreach. Foundation tenants do not access the pool. Growth tenants can match to it. Kingdom tenants run their own outbound recruiting.

How is our data secured?

Hosted on Supabase Postgres with daily backups and point-in-time recovery. Tenant isolation is enforced at the database layer through row-level security. Integration tokens are encrypted in Supabase Vault. SSL across the platform. MFA required for admin roles. Payments processed through Stripe for PCI compliance.

Do we need a dedicated app?

No. DiscipleIQ is a progressive web app. Same experience on phones, tablets, and desktops. Native iOS and Android apps sit on the longer-term roadmap, not in V1.
